The IOC chose Russia has two silver medals from the Olympics-2014

МОК отобрал у России еще два серебра с Олимпиады-2014The international Olympic Committee (IOC) announced new sanctions against Russian athletes.

Lifetime suspension with the cancellation of the results at the Olympic games 2014 in Sochi won the Luge albert Demchenko and Tatyana Ivanova, skiers Nikita Kryukov, Alexander Bessmertnykh and Natalia Matveeva, skaters Ivan Skobrev and Artem Kuznetsov, bobsledder Ludmila Dobkin and Maxim Belugin and hockey players Tatiana burina and Anna Shchuchkin.

At the 2014 Olympics in Sochi Demchenko won second place in the individual event and the relay, and Ivanov won silver in the relay. After the cancellation of the results of the Russians awards bronze dignity will get the Andi Langenhan (Germany) and team Canada (Alex Gough, Samuel Adni, Tristan Walker and Justin can figure it).

Russia already took 13 medals from the Olympic games-2014:

Gold: Alexander Tretiakov (skeleton), Alexander Zubkov/Alexey Voevoda (bobsleigh), Alexander Legkov (skiing), the men’s team of Russia in bobsleigh.

Silver: Olga Vilukhina (biathlon), Olga Fatkulina (speed skating), men’s team of Russia in ski racing, Maxim Vylegzhanin/Nikita
Hooks (ski race), the women’s relay in biathlon and Maxim Vylegzhanin (cross-country skiing), albert Demchenko and Tatyana Ivanova (both Luge).

Bronze: Elena Nikitina (skeleton).
